F01 Smeg Cooker Error Code: What It Means and How to Fix It

The F01 error code on a Smeg cooker indicates a fault with the oven’s temperature sensor (NTC probe), meaning your appliance cannot accurately read or regulate the internal oven temperature. While it sounds alarming, in many cases this is a fixable issue — and in some instances a simple reset is all it takes. In this guide, you’ll learn exactly what F01 means on a Smeg cooker, the most likely causes, what you can safely do yourself, and when it’s time to call in a professional.

What does this error mean?

The F01 error code on a Smeg cooker (including models in the A-series, Victoria, and Portofino ranges) is triggered when the oven’s electronic control board detects a problem with the NTC temperature sensor — also known as the oven probe or thermostat sensor. This small component sits inside the oven cavity and continuously sends temperature readings back to the control board, allowing the oven to maintain the correct heat. When the control board receives a reading that is out of range — either because the sensor has failed, its wiring has been damaged, or there’s a loose connection — it throws the F01 fault code and typically disables the oven to prevent overheating or underheating your food. In short: your Smeg cooker has lost confidence in its ability to control the oven temperature safely, so it has shut itself down. This is a safety-first measure, not a catastrophic failure.

🔍 Likely causes

Faulty or failed NTC temperature sensor (oven probe): The most common cause. The sensor degrades over time, especially in heavily used ovens, and eventually stops returning accurate readings to the control board.Loose or disconnected wiring to the NTC sensor: The sensor connects to the control board via a wiring harness. Vibration, heat cycles, or previous servicing can cause the connector to work loose, triggering the F01 fault even if the sensor itself is fine.Burned or damaged sensor wiring: The wires running from the NTC probe through the oven cavity are exposed to high heat over years of use. They can become brittle, frayed, or short-circuited against the oven casing, causing intermittent or permanent F01 faults.Control board (PCB) fault: Less commonly, the main electronic control board itself may have failed or developed a fault in the circuit that reads the sensor signal. If a new sensor doesn’t clear the error, this is the next suspect.Oven overheated due to a blocked cooling fan or vent: If the oven cavity has overheated significantly (for example due to a blocked cooling fan), the thermal protection may have tripped alongside an F01 reading. This is more common in fan-assisted Smeg ovens.Residue or grease contamination on the sensor probe tip: In rarely cleaned ovens, a heavy build-up of carbonised grease directly on the sensor probe can insulate it, causing inaccurate readings that trigger the fault code.Recent power surge or electrical interruption: A sudden power cut or voltage spike can cause the control board to misread the sensor and lock out with an F01 fault, even when the sensor is perfectly healthy.

🛠️ Step-by-step fix

1

Step 1 — Turn the cooker off and perform a hard reset: Switch the cooker off at the wall socket (or at the fuse spur/consumer unit if there is no accessible plug), leave it completely unpowered for at least 5–10 minutes, then switch it back on. This allows the control board to reboot fully. If the F01 code was caused by a temporary power glitch, this alone may clear it. No tools required.

2

Step 2 — Check your Smeg model’s manual for a manual reset procedure: Some Smeg cooker models have a specific reset sequence (for example, holding down a button combination on the control panel). Locate your model number (usually on a sticker inside the oven door frame or on the back of the appliance) and download the user manual from Smeg’s UK website (smeguk.com) if you don’t have it to hand. Follow any reset instructions specific to your model.

3

Step 3 — Inspect and clean the NTC temperature sensor probe: With the oven completely cooled down and the power disconnected at the wall, open the oven door and look for the NTC sensor probe. On most Smeg ovens it is a small metal pin or rod, roughly 3–5 cm long, mounted on the back wall or side wall of the oven cavity, held in place by one or two screws. Using a soft cloth or fine wire brush, gently clean any carbonised grease or residue from the tip of the probe. Repower the oven and check if the F01 code has cleared.

4

Step 4 — Check the sensor probe is physically secure: With the power disconnected, gently try to wiggle the sensor probe. If it feels loose in its mounting bracket, tighten the retaining screw(s) using a Torx or Philips screwdriver (check which type your model uses — most Smeg ovens use Torx T20). A loose probe can cause intermittent contact and trigger F01. Repower and test.

5

Step 5 — Test the NTC sensor resistance with a multimeter (confident DIYers only): If you own a multimeter and are comfortable using it, you can test whether the NTC sensor has failed. Disconnect the power, carefully unscrew the sensor probe from the oven wall, and unplug its wiring connector. Set your multimeter to measure resistance (Ohms/Ω). At room temperature (approximately 20°C), a healthy Smeg NTC oven sensor should read approximately 900–1,100 Ω. A reading of zero (short circuit) or infinite resistance (open circuit) confirms the sensor has failed and needs replacing. Note: you are not opening any live electrical components in this step — the sensor connector is accessible from inside the oven cavity.

6

Step 6 — Replace the NTC temperature sensor if it has failed: Smeg NTC oven sensors are a widely available spare part in the UK. Search for your specific Smeg model number followed by ‘NTC sensor’ or ‘oven temperature probe’ on sites such as 4WheeledDriving.co.uk, eSpares, or ApplianceSpareparts.co.uk. Genuine Smeg parts typically cost £15–£35. With the power disconnected, unscrew the old sensor (usually 1–2 screws), unplug the wiring connector, plug in the new sensor, refit the screws, restore power, and check whether the F01 code has cleared.

7

Step 7 — Inspect the sensor wiring for visible damage: If replacing the sensor doesn’t resolve F01, with the power disconnected, carefully trace the wiring from the sensor probe towards the back of the oven. Look for any sections of wire that appear discoloured, melted, or frayed. Minor loose connections at the plug-in connector can sometimes be carefully reseated. However, if you find burned or damaged wiring inside the appliance body, stop here and call a qualified appliance engineer — do not attempt to repair internal wiring yourself.

8

Step 8 — Do not attempt to access or replace the control board (PCB) yourself: If all the above steps have failed to clear F01, the fault likely lies with the main control board. Replacing a PCB on a Smeg cooker involves dismantling the appliance and working near live electrical components. This is not a safe DIY task for a homeowner without appliance repair training. At this point, call a professional engineer and tell them you’ve already replaced the NTC sensor and checked the wiring.

📞 When to call a professional

You should call a qualified appliance engineer (not a gas engineer, unless your Smeg is a dual-fuel model with a gas hob) in the following situations: the F01 error persists after a hard reset and cleaning the sensor probe; the sensor tests faulty on a multimeter and you’re not comfortable replacing it yourself; you’ve installed a new NTC sensor but the error code is still present (suggesting a wiring or PCB fault); or you’ve spotted damaged, burned, or frayed wiring inside the appliance. When you call, tell the engineer: ‘My Smeg cooker is showing an F01 error code, which I understand relates to the NTC temperature sensor. I’ve already tried a hard reset and [list what else you’ve attempted], but the fault is still present.’ This saves diagnostic time and money. If your Smeg cooker is a dual-fuel model (gas hob, electric oven), and the F01 fault is accompanied by any issue with the gas hob, always contact a Gas Safe registered engineer (you can find one at gassaferegister.co.uk). Do not attempt any work on gas components yourself.

⚖️ Repair or replace?

For most Smeg cookers showing F01, repair is the right first move — provided the appliance is under 10 years old and otherwise in good condition. Smeg is a premium Italian brand with good parts availability in the UK, and NTC sensors are inexpensive and straightforward to replace. If the fault turns out to be a failed control board (PCB), costs rise significantly: a PCB for a Smeg cooker typically costs £80–£180 for the part alone, plus £60–£100 labour, bringing the total to £140–£280. At that level, weigh the repair cost against the age of the appliance. A Smeg cooker purchased new in the UK costs anywhere from £600 for an entry-level model to over £3,000 for a Portofino range cooker. As a general rule: if the cooker is under 8 years old and the repair quote is less than 40% of the replacement cost, repair. If it’s over 12 years old or the repair quote is high relative to its current value, it may be more economical to replace. Always ask the engineer for a written quote before authorising PCB replacement work.
